MACHIAS, Maine (AP) - The head of campus at University of Maine at Machias is set to leave the school just a year after he started.
The Bangor Daily News reports that head of campus and Vice President of Academic Affairs Andrew Egan plans to step down Aug. 15
Egan was the first person hired from outside the university system to become the campus’s top official since the school became a regional campus in July 2017.
Education professor Daniel Quall will serves as interim vice president for academic affairs and head of campus.
